Output 904e604b0c493addc08fa309ec81c997c5988f7accf3f994f7a1c36ec3b6ea5d:10

value
70000
script pubkey
OP_0 OP_PUSHBYTES_20 efcf7cdda846a59ea9bcdba33e4e01edd93f44c8
address
bc1qal8hehdgg6jea2dumw3nunspahvn73xgm8t206
transaction
904e604b0c493addc08fa309ec81c997c5988f7accf3f994f7a1c36ec3b6ea5d
confirmations
117306
spent
true